Penetration testing, also known as ethical hacking, is a proactive approach to assessing an organization’s cybersecurity defenses. It involves simulating cyberattacks to identify potential vulnerabilities that malicious actors could exploit. As cyber threats continue to grow, the benefits of penetration testing have become increasingly apparent for businesses in various sectors.
Organizations can rely on this cybersecurity assessment to uncover weak spots in their systems, such as outdated software or improper configurations. By identifying these issues early, companies can implement stronger security measures, ensuring sensitive data is protected. Regular penetration tests provide valuable insights into a company’s defenses, highlighting areas that require attention.
Industries like finance, healthcare, and e-commerce greatly benefit from penetration testing due to the high value of their data and the legal compliance requirements they face. Understanding why penetration testing is essential helps businesses enhance their security and mitigate the risks associated with cyberattacks.
1. Identifies Security Vulnerabilities
One of the major benefits of penetration testing is its ability to uncover hidden weaknesses in a company’s network, applications, or systems. Through a simulated cyberattack, penetration testers perform a thorough cybersecurity assessment to identify gaps that could be exploited by malicious actors.
a) How Vulnerability Testing Works:
- Ethical hackers use advanced tools and techniques to mimic real-world attacks.
- They target known vulnerabilities, such as outdated software, weak passwords, or misconfigured firewalls.
- Once vulnerabilities are identified, the business receives a report detailing the risks and how to address them.
b) Benefits of Early Detection:
- Vulnerability testing helps businesses find issues before cybercriminals do, giving them time to patch weaknesses and prevent potential breaches.
- Common vulnerabilities include cross-site scripting (XSS), SQL injections, and broken authentication methods.
- Early detection reduces the chances of data breaches, operational downtime, and damage to the company’s reputation.
2. Protects Sensitive Data
Protecting sensitive data is one of the most critical benefits of penetration testing for businesses today. With increasing incidents of data breaches, securing customer information, financial data, and proprietary business details has become a priority. Network security testing through penetration tests plays a vital role in ensuring this protection.
a) How Penetration Testing Safeguards Data:
- Simulated attacks reveal vulnerabilities that could expose sensitive information.
- Penetration testers identify weak spots in encryption protocols, data storage, and access control systems.
- Businesses gain insight into how attackers might bypass existing security measures.
b) Importance of Data Protection:
- Data breaches result in significant financial losses, legal consequences, and damaged reputations.
- Penetration tests help secure critical information by identifying risks before they are exploited.
- Regular testing ensures ongoing protection as new vulnerabilities emerge, keeping sensitive data safe.
3. Enhances Incident Response
Preparing for cyberattacks requires more than just preventive measures. One of the significant penetration testing advantages is its ability to enhance an organization’s incident response. By simulating real-world attacks, businesses can test and improve how well their teams react when an actual threat emerges.
a) How Penetration Testing Improves Incident Response:
- Penetration testers simulate various attack scenarios, allowing the security team to practice detecting, containing, and mitigating these threats.
- The test results highlight weak areas in the incident response plan that need improvement.
- Penetration testing provides valuable insights into the speed and efficiency of current response protocols.
b) Benefits of Improved Incident Response:
- Faster response times reduce the impact of a cyberattack, limiting data loss and financial damage.
- Case studies show that businesses with effective incident response plans have reduced downtime and recovery costs after cyber incidents.
- Regular vulnerability testing through penetration tests ensures the incident response team stays sharp and ready for new types of attacks.
4. Ensures Compliance with Regulations
Meeting regulatory standards is essential for many businesses, especially those handling sensitive data. One of the benefits of penetration testing is its ability to help organizations comply with security regulations like GDPR, HIPAA, and PCI DSS. Non-compliance can result in hefty fines and legal consequences, making it critical for businesses to regularly assess their security posture.
a) How Penetration Testing Supports Compliance:
- Security audits performed through penetration testing ensure that companies meet the required security standards.
- These tests identify areas where existing security measures may fall short of compliance.
- Regular penetration testing can be used as evidence of due diligence during audits, showing that the organization actively works to protect its systems.
b) Penalties of Non-Compliance:
- Failure to meet regulatory standards can lead to financial penalties, loss of customer trust, and legal actions.
- Penetration tests help businesses avoid these risks by identifying weaknesses that could lead to breaches.
5. Reduces Downtime
Cyberattacks and system failures often lead to significant downtime, which can disrupt business operations and lead to financial losses. One of the benefits of penetration testing is that it helps reduce downtime by identifying and fixing vulnerabilities before they are exploited. By proactively addressing these weak points, businesses can ensure smooth operations without unexpected interruptions.
a) How Penetration Testing Minimizes Downtime:
- Network security testing identifies potential threats that could lead to system failures or ransomware attacks, which often cause prolonged downtime.
- By resolving these vulnerabilities, businesses avoid costly interruptions in services that could affect both employees and customers.
- Penetration tests assess how well current systems handle attacks, ensuring that backups and recovery plans are in place to quickly restore operations if a breach occurs.
b) Importance of Business Continuity:
- Reducing downtime is essential for maintaining customer trust and avoiding operational bottlenecks.
- Industries that rely heavily on continuous service, such as finance or e-commerce, benefit greatly from vulnerability testing as it safeguards uptime and prevents major disruptions.
# | Tip | Description |
1 | Implement Regular Backups | Schedule frequent backups to ensure data recovery in case of system failure or cyberattack. |
2 | Use Redundant Systems | Set up redundant servers and networks to ensure business continuity during outages. |
3 | Monitor Systems in Real Time | Use monitoring tools to detect issues early and respond quickly before they escalate. |
4 | Maintain Updated Security Patches | Regularly update software to prevent vulnerabilities that can cause system downtime. |
5 | Establish a Disaster Recovery Plan | Create a detailed plan for quick recovery after a major system failure or breach. |
6 | Use Load Balancing | Distribute traffic across servers to prevent overloads and reduce the risk of downtime. |
7 | Train Employees on Incident Response | Ensure employees know how to respond to incidents to minimize downtime. |
8 | Automate Routine Maintenance | Automate tasks like software updates and monitoring to prevent human error and downtime. |
6. Validates Existing Security Measures
Penetration testing goes beyond identifying new vulnerabilities; it also validates the effectiveness of existing security measures. Regular cybersecurity assessments ensure that your current defenses, such as firewalls, encryption protocols, and access controls, function as intended to protect against emerging threats.
a) How Penetration Testing Evaluates Security Systems:
- Network security testing checks whether firewalls, intrusion detection systems, and antivirus solutions can withstand simulated attacks.
- Ethical hackers examine how well vulnerability testing and patch management systems are implemented to detect and respond to threats.
- The testing process highlights any gaps or misconfigurations in security tools that might leave the system exposed.
b) Why Validation is Essential:
- Businesses invest heavily in security solutions, and penetration testing ensures these investments deliver security testing benefits.
- Validating existing defenses prevents a false sense of security, ensuring that all protective measures are optimized for real-world attack scenarios.
No. | Security Measure | How Pen Testing Validates |
1 | Firewalls | Tests for proper configuration and rule bypass |
2 | Encryption protocols | Ensures strong encryption and proper key management |
3 | Access control mechanisms | Validates role-based access control and permissions |
4 | Intrusion detection systems | Simulates attacks to test detection capabilities |
5 | Web application security | Assesses protection against common vulnerabilities like SQL injection and XSS |
7. Improves Security Awareness
Another key benefit of penetration testing is its ability to raise security awareness among employees and IT teams. Conducting regular cybersecurity assessments helps organizations stay informed about emerging threats and potential vulnerabilities, ensuring that both technical and non-technical staff remain vigilant.
a) How Penetration Testing Enhances Awareness:
- Ethical hackers can demonstrate real-world attack scenarios, helping employees understand how easily attackers can exploit weak points in a network.
- Penetration test reports provide insights into vulnerabilities and offer actionable steps for teams to strengthen security protocols.
- Regular testing encourages a culture of cybersecurity, where employees actively participate in safeguarding sensitive information by following best practices, such as using strong passwords and recognizing phishing attempts.
b) Why Raising Awareness Matters:
- Employee mistakes, such as falling for phishing scams, are a common entry point for cyberattacks. Increased awareness minimizes these risks.
- Engaging IT teams through security audits helps them improve their skills and respond effectively to new attack methods.
# | Security Best Practice | Description |
1 | Use Strong, Unique Passwords | Create complex passwords and avoid reusing them across multiple sites and services. |
2 | Enable Two-Factor Authentication | Add an extra layer of security by requiring a second form of identification. |
3 | Keep Software Updated | Regularly update operating systems and applications to patch vulnerabilities. |
4 | Avoid Phishing Scams | Be cautious of suspicious emails or messages and don’t click on unverified links. |
5 | Use a VPN on Public Networks | Encrypt your internet connection on unsecured Wi-Fi to protect personal data. |
6 | Backup Important Data Regularly | Regular backups ensure you don’t lose essential information in case of a cyber attack. |
7 | Limit Personal Information Sharing | Be mindful of the personal data you share online and adjust privacy settings accordingly. |
8. Protects Business Reputation
Maintaining a strong reputation is vital for any organization, and one of the key benefits of penetration testing is its role in safeguarding that reputation. A single data breach can severely damage a company’s image, leading to lost customers and diminished trust. Regular penetration tests help prevent such incidents by identifying and addressing vulnerabilities before they are exploited.
a) How Penetration Testing Safeguards Reputation:
- Ethical hacking benefits organizations by proactively finding security gaps, ensuring that sensitive data remains protected.
- Penetration testers simulate real-world attacks, demonstrating the effectiveness of your security audits and reassuring stakeholders of your commitment to security.
- Detailed reports from cybersecurity assessments provide transparency, showing customers and partners that you take their security seriously.
b) Importance of a Strong Reputation:
- A solid reputation builds customer trust, encouraging loyalty and repeat business.
- Businesses known for robust security measures attract more clients, especially those in industries where data protection is paramount.
- Avoiding data breaches through vulnerability testing minimizes negative publicity and financial losses associated with remediation and legal actions.
9. Provides Actionable Insights
One of the most significant benefits of penetration testing is the detailed, actionable insights it provides. After completing a penetration test, businesses receive comprehensive reports outlining discovered vulnerabilities and recommendations for fixing them. These insights are not just technical; they offer strategic guidance for improving overall security.
a) How Penetration Testing Delivers Actionable Insights:
- Cybersecurity assessments generate reports that highlight weaknesses in applications, networks, and systems.
- The findings include specific vulnerabilities, their potential impact, and clear steps for mitigation.
- Reports prioritize risks, allowing organizations to address the most critical threats first and allocate resources effectively.
b) Why Actionable Insights Matter:
- Actionable data empowers IT teams to make informed decisions and implement necessary fixes quickly.
- Companies gain a clear understanding of their security testing benefits and can track improvements over time.
- The feedback loop created by regular vulnerability testing ensures organizations remain proactive in addressing evolving threats.
10. Saves Costs in the Long Run
One of the most practical benefits of penetration testing is the cost savings it provides over time. While some companies may view penetration testing as an added expense, this proactive approach prevents costly incidents such as data breaches, regulatory fines, and operational downtime.
a) How Penetration Testing Saves Money:
- Vulnerability testing helps organizations identify weak points early, allowing them to address potential issues before they escalate into expensive breaches.
- Avoiding data breaches means businesses can save millions in recovery costs, legal fees, and reputational damage.
- Regular network security testing ensures that security controls are continuously updated, preventing the need for large-scale overhauls after a breach.
b) Why It’s a Smart Investment:
- Investing in penetration testing is more affordable than the costs associated with a full-scale cyberattack, which often leads to customer loss, fines for non-compliance, and recovery efforts.
- The long-term security testing benefits far outweigh the initial cost, as businesses maintain stronger defenses and lower their risk of future incidents.
Conclusion
Regular penetration testing is an essential strategy for organizations seeking to enhance their security posture. The benefits of penetration testing go beyond identifying vulnerabilities; they provide businesses with a proactive way to protect sensitive data, maintain regulatory compliance, and prevent costly downtime. Organizations gain peace of mind knowing that their security measures are tested and validated through real-world attack simulations.
From improving incident response to delivering security testing benefits that save costs in the long run, penetration testing is a worthwhile investment for companies of all sizes. Understanding why penetration testing should be an integral part of your cybersecurity strategy can lead to better decision-making and stronger defenses against cyber threats.
To remain competitive and secure in today’s threat landscape, businesses must prioritize consistent cybersecurity assessments through penetration testing. This preventive measure ensures long-term protection and fosters trust among customers and stakeholders alike.
–
This blog is brought to you by Content Whale, where we specialize in creating content that not only ranks but also drives real results. If you’re ready to lead your industry with expertly crafted, SEO-optimized content, reach out to us today. Let’s work together to achieve your business goals with professionalism and impact.
FAQs
1. What is penetration testing and why is it important?
Penetration testing is a proactive cybersecurity assessment where ethical hackers simulate cyberattacks to identify vulnerabilities in systems, networks, or applications. Its importance lies in revealing weaknesses that could lead to breaches, helping businesses prevent costly attacks and enhance their defenses.
2. How often should organizations conduct penetration testing?
Regular testing is recommended, at least annually, or whenever significant changes are made to the IT infrastructure. This ensures that security measures are always up to date and provides ongoing security testing benefits.
3. How does penetration testing help meet compliance requirements?
Many industries, such as healthcare and finance, require strict adherence to data protection regulations. Penetration testing helps ensure compliance by identifying areas where security may not meet regulatory standards, providing reports that can be used in security audits.
4. What kind of vulnerabilities can penetration testing uncover?
Penetration testing can expose vulnerabilities such as weak passwords, outdated software, and misconfigured firewalls. It also identifies risks related to network security testing and data encryption protocols.
5. What are the long-term financial benefits of penetration testing?
By preventing data breaches and minimizing downtime, penetration testing offers long-term cost savings. Addressing vulnerabilities early reduces recovery costs and legal fees, making it a smart investment for businesses looking to secure their operations and protect sensitive data.